This is an excellent question which is specific to the terms of agreement that you signed with the company you used for your home warranty. Basically some do provide separate clauses about needing to be at the house for the warranty to be valid while others do not. My best advice would be to find your agreement and read through it very carefully.

I am a Colonial Home Warranty customer and am currently under a 3-year contract. (I am in no way affiliated with any home warranty companies and am just an average homeowner with my only "agenda" being that I would like fairness and professionalism from the companies with which I do business. Having said that, I am EXTREMELY dissatisfied with Colonial's customer service. I have finally given in to their completely unreasonable "Buyout" offer in lieu of repair or replacement of my dishwasher because I can see that there is absolutely zero chance of reasoning, let alone even speaking, with anyone on any "management" level to discuss the merits of my appeal. My appeal letters have been ignored, my emails have also been ignored, my phone calls have not been returned, and I have been told that there are no supervisors available to speak with as "they are all very busy" and there is nothing more that can be done for me. Colonial chose to take the cheapest way out when a repair was possible for a reasonable cost. The company will hide behind the fine print in your contract and bank on the fact that you probably will not actually ever choose to arbitrate their poor customer service since the cost to you to do so would be too high. DO NOT conduct business with this company. My previous home warranty was with American Home Shield. It expired, so I went with Colonial after being bribed by their slick salesman on the phone, however I will not be renewing my Colonial contract (American Home Shield has much better customer service.) I urge you to NOT conduct business with Colonial Home Warranty Company.
